This Week in Air Force Life Cycle Management Center History and Spotlight on Eglin AFB
WRIGHT-PATTERSON AFB, Ohio, Nov. 9 -- The U.S. Air Force Life Cycle Management Center issued the following news on Nov. 8, 2021:
8 Nov 1968 (ISR & SOF Dir.)
Tactical Air Command received its first Fairchild AC-119K "Stinger" gun-ship. It was the product of Project Gunship III, the third iteration propeller-driven cargo aircraft equipped with cannons and machine guns as a ground support/attack platform.
